ABSTRACT
<p><b>OBJECTIVE</b>To investigate the relationship between polymorphisms of the growth arrest specific 6 (GAS6) gene and severe preeclampsia in a South West Han Chinese population.</p><p><b>METHODS</b>Blood samples from 167 patients with severe preeclampsia and 312 normal pregnant women as controls from Han Chinese in Chengdu area were analyzed by polymerase chain reaction-restriction fragment length polymorphisms.</p><p><b>RESULTS</b>C and T allele frequencies for +1332C/T site were 85.63% and 14.37% in the patient group, respectively, and 78.04% and 21.96% in control group, respectively. The TT genotype and variant T allelic frequencies of the +1332C/T polymorphism were significantly lower in patients with severe preeclampsia than in the control group (both P<0.05), and the odds ratio for the risk of severe preeclampsia was 0.602 (95%CI 0.401-0.904) in carriers for the variant T allele (χ=6.045, P=0.014). G and A allele frequencies for 834+7G/A site were 72.75% and 27.25% in case group, respectively, and 74.36% and 25.64% in control group, respectively. The genotype and allele frequencies of the 834+7G/A polymorphism in patients with severe preeclampsia and controls showed no significant differences (both P>0.05). In addition, there was no significant association between the polymorphisms and blood pressure levels in the patient or control groups.</p><p><b>CONCLUSION</b>The variant GAS6+1332 T allele is associated with a decreased risk for severe preeclampsia in a South West Han Chinese population. On the other hand, the 834+7G/A polymorphism has no effect on the severe preeclampsia.</p>
